Output 5dff170858b2a237d505b39a09aad9bf208f3e775ccbcf5b6ae72d8b42a2e9ad:107

value
10061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850761c92fe638f768247b25eb5719c19267f441 OP_EQUAL
address
3DpQdxyWs5dgCBGtpzXEYKPuzK5tug1Ko7
transaction
5dff170858b2a237d505b39a09aad9bf208f3e775ccbcf5b6ae72d8b42a2e9ad
confirmations
331619
spent
true